Abstract
Topic Detection and Tracking (TDT) refer to the technologies and techniques in analysing and handling the vast amount of information arriving continuously from the news stream. Some issues in news monitoring regarding interface design are considered. In this paper we present the techniques and works done in TDT domain. We discuss the named entities approach used in document representation and in user interface. Finally, we present the suggested approach to improve users´ performance and to facilitate them to perform an effective TDT task.
